#516251 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#516251 is composed of 31.8% red, 38.4%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 17.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.3%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 120 degrees, a saturation of 9.5% and a lightness of 35.1%. #516251 color hex could be obtained by blending #a2c4a2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

#516251 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#516251 has RGB values of R:81, G:98, B:81 and CMYK values of C:0.17, M:0, Y:0.17,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 5333585.

Shades and Tints of #516251
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f6f7f6 is the lightest one.
